Craig Dailey
Stopped in for lunch with my son who’s going to school at UTC. He recommended it from previous visit with his girlfriend. They offer the kind of Mexican food that’s clearly designed with the American palate in mind, less fiery authenticity, more comfort and crowd-pleasing flavor. Still, it’s absolutely worth stopping in to try for yourself.

The portions are huge, and the plates are balanced nicely between protein and vegetables. The standout of our meal was the chorizo queso dip, perfectly creamy and rich without being overly greasy, with just the right infusion of chorizo flavor.

I went with the carne asada, which was good, though it didn’t quite pack the level of spice I was hoping for. Interestingly, the meat in my son’s burrito hit closer to that flavor profile I expected. Next time, I’m eyeing the birria to see if they can earn that fifth star.

Service was excellent; attentive, fast, and friendly. I didn’t try any of their margaritas or cocktails, but the bar looked well-stocked and inviting. All in all, El Tapatio delivers a satisfying meal in a relaxed, family-friendly setting.
